About

The main purpose of this study is to compare effectiveness of two different culture media for cultivation of Borrelia burgdorferi sensu lato from skin specimens obtained from patients with erythema migrans.

Inclusion criteria

  • erythema migrans in patients > 18 years

Exclusion criteria

  • pregnancy or lactation
  • taking antibiotic with antiborrelial activity within 10 days
  • erythema migrans localized on face or neck

Each patient (235 subjects) provided two skin samples (470 skin samples).

MKP media versus BSK-H media
Active Comparator group
Description:
one half of skin specimen obtained from erythema migrans patients was cultivated for Borrelia burgdorferi sensu lato in MKP media and the other half in BSK-H media
